免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

安装微信小程序开发工具

微信小程序是面向用户,通过微信进行分享和传播的一种小型应用程序。通过微信小程序开发工具,我们可以开发自己的小程序,让人们通过微信来使用我们的应用。本文将为你介绍安装微信小程序开发工具的方法及原理。

一、下载微信小程序开发工具

首先,我们需要去微信官方网站进行下载微信小程序开发工具。下载地址为:https://developers.weixin.qq.com/miniprogram/dev/devtools/download.html

下载完成后,我们可以双击下载的安装包,按照提示完成安装。

二、打开微信小程序开发工具

安装完成后,我们双击打开微信小程序开发工具。进入到微信小程序开发工具界面后,可以看到左侧有一个类似于文件管理器的部分,右侧则是代码编辑区域。

三、创建小程序项目

1. 点击左上角的“新建项目”。

2. 输入项目名称,选择项目保存路径。

3. 选择项目类型(小程序或小游戏)。

4. 输入小程序 AppID。

5. 点击确定,创建项目。

小程序 AppID 的获取需要先前注册微信公众平台账号,再进入小程序管理界面进行注册。

四、小程序开发工具中的各功能区域介绍

1. 代码区域:代码编辑、查看调试信息。

2. 资源区域:管理项目中的图片、音频、视频等资源。

3. 日志区域:查看小程序的运行日志。

4. 接口调试区域:用于测试小程序的接口。

5. 插件区域:添加第三方插件。

6. 分享区域:分享小程序给好友。

7. 预览区域:查看小程序的预览效果。

五、微信小程序开发工具的原理

微信小程序开发工具基于 Chromium 内核和 NodeJS 实现的一款桌面应用程序。其运行时的核心是 WebView 所提供的 JavaScript 运行环境。

微信小程序基于组件化开发,开发者通过创建一个页面来组装组件在页面中的展示和功能。小程序的页面是由 WXML(微信小程序的组件化语言)和 WXSS(微信小程序的样式表语言)组成的模板。WXML 是一种类似于 HTML 的标记语言,用于描述小程序页面结构,WXSS 则是一种类似于 CSS 的语言,用于编写小程序的样式。

微信小程序在开发者工具中进行编辑调试,调试完成后开发者需点击预览按钮,将小程序预览到微信客户端中才能进行真正的用户测试。

总之,微信小程序开发工具是一个重要的辅助开发工具,通过这个工具开发者可以更好地完成微信小程序的开发、调试、预览和发布等相关操作,为小程序开发者提供了便捷的开发环境和实现方法。


相关知识:
百度小程序用什么语言开发
百度小程序是一种可以在百度App内运行的轻量级应用程序,它可以提供与原生应用类似的功能和交互体验。百度小程序的开发语言主要有两种:JavaScript和Lark(百度自研的一种类似于JavaScript的编程语言)。1. JavaScript开发:百度小程
2023-08-23
阿坝支付宝小程序开发
阿坝支付宝小程序是一种轻量级的应用程序,提供了与支付宝进行交互的功能。其本质是一种类似于网页的应用程序,运行在支付宝客户端内部。小程序是一个独立的应用程序,可以在支付宝中运行。小程序有自己的生命周期和视图层,在支付宝客户端内部运行,具有快速加载、数据传递、
2023-08-09
爱润妍小程序开发
爱润妍小程序是一种基于微信平台的轻量级应用程序,可以在微信中直接使用,无需下载安装即可使用。它的开发语言是类似HTML、CSS和JavaScript的WXML、WXSS和JS,大多数开发者都可以通过学习和了解这些语言来开发自己的小程序。小程序分为前端和后端
2023-08-09
安徽餐饮外卖类小程序开发平台
随着人们日益繁忙的生活节奏和外出就餐的频率的增加,餐饮外卖市场变得日益繁荣。为了满足消费者的需求,安徽餐饮外卖类小程序已成为了越来越多的餐饮企业必备的工具。本文将介绍安徽餐饮外卖类小程序的开发平台和原理。安徽餐饮外卖类小程序开发平台是指开发者可以使用的一套
2023-08-09
安徽合肥小程序开发
小程序是一种轻量级的应用程序,其在微信、支付宝等社交平台上被广泛使用。安徽合肥的企业,如零售店、餐厅和酒店,都可以通过开发小程序来提高他们的业务效率并获得更多的客户。本文将讨论小程序的原理以及如何在安徽合肥开发小程序。小程序原理小程序是基于微信开发平台开发
2023-08-09
taro开发小程序的生命周期
Taro是一个支持多端开发的前端框架,其中小程序就是其支持的其中一种端。在对小程序的开发中,前端框架的生命周期是一个非常重要和基础的概念。那么,接下来我将会详细地介绍一下Taro开发小程序的生命周期。生命周期指的是组件从创建到销毁的整个过程,包含了组件不同
2023-08-09
swift语言能开发小程序吗
Swift是一门由苹果公司开发的编程语言,于2014年发布。这门语言在短期内迅速成为了iOS开发中主要的编程语言之一,在开源之后也开始扩展到了服务器端和其它平台开发。当然,Swift语言也可以用于开发小程序。虽然Swift没有专门的小程序框架,但SSwif
2023-08-09
qq小程序定制开发
随着移动互联网的发展,小程序应运而生,成为了一种新型的互联网应用形态。在小程序中,QQ小程序也属于一种相对来说较为常见的小程序形态,在QQ平台上,利用QQ小程序可以实现许多非常有用的功能,甚至可以开发促使QQ平台整体发展的应用。当然,与其他小程序一样,QQ
2023-08-09
in壁纸小程序谁开发的
in壁纸小程序是由in壁纸团队开发的一款高清壁纸应用程序,为用户提供优质的壁纸图片,同时支持用户上传和分享壁纸。in壁纸小程序采用了微信小程序开发框架,实现了小程序的基本架构和核心功能。整个小程序由前端和后端两部分组成,前端使用了wepy框架,后端则使用n
2023-08-09
blazor开发小程序
Blazor是一种新型的Web应用程序框架,它允许开发人员在浏览器中使用C#编写交互性网站的代码。Blazor通常使用WebAssembly运行时,这使得它的性能和功能与更传统的框架相当。 然而, Blazor也可以在服务器端运行,这使得在所有的浏览器中运
2023-08-09
小程序开发工具导入项目后空白的格式
小程序开发工具是一款方便快捷的开发工具,用于创建、编译和调试小程序,并拥有项目管理、代码编辑等功能。然而,有时候在导入项目后,我们会发现小程序开发工具窗口空白,没有任何可编辑的页面和代码。这个问题通常是由以下几个原因引起的:1.项目未正确导入在导入项目的过
2023-05-26
昆明小程序开发工具代理
小程序开发工具是小程序开发的重要工具,它提供了小程序的开发、测试、预览等功能,极大地方便了小程序的开发者。但是,由于某些原因,有些地区的开发者经常会遇到小程序开发工具无法连接的问题,这时候就需要使用代理工具才能正常使用小程序开发工具。代理是指一个计算机代表
2023-05-26